You can achieve the same effect by calling MatAssemblyBegin/End Il giorno lun 8 mag 2023 alle ore 15:54 Pichler, Franz < [email protected]> ha scritto:
Hello, i am using petsc in a single cpu setup where I have preassembled crs matrices that I wrap via PetSC’s
MatCreateSeqAIJWithArrays Functionality.
Now I manipulate the values of these matrices (wohtout changing the sparsity) without using petsc,
When I now want to solve again I have to call
PetscObjectStateIncrease((PetscObject)petsc_A);
So that oetsc actually solves again (otherwise thinking nothing hs changed ,
This means I have to include the private header
#include <petsc/private/petscimpl.h>
Which makes a seamingless implementation of petsc into a cmake process more complicate (This guy has to be stated explicitly in the cmake process at the moment)
I would like to resolve that by “going” around the private header,
My first intuition was to increase the state by hand
((PetscObject)petsc_A_aux[the_sys])->state++;
This is the definition of petscstateincrease in the header. This throws me an
error: invalid use of incomplete type ‘struct _p_PetscObject’
compilation error.
Is there any elegeant way around this?
